Directions

  1. 1

    Mix lemon juice, salt and pepper, fold in oil. Peel garlic and chop finely. Wash and pluck the basil and cut into strips. Add garlic to the marinade

  2. 2

    Drain the tuna and finely pluck with a fork. Mix the tuna with the basil marinade. Leave to stand for at least 20 minutes

  3. 3

    Toast bread. Spread the tuna fish on top. Arrange crostini on salad leaves. Garnish with tomato quarters, lemon slices and basil

  4. 4

    Ciabatta is an Italian white bread, which you can get fresh at the baker's or packed for ready baking in the bread shelf. Alternatively, you can use baguette, bread by the meter or normal white bread. You can prepare the tuna well and later arrange it on the bread slices
